> I wanted to share some recent updates for anyone developing for CS:GO that > hasn't been exposed to Wall Worm. WW 2.0+ was recently released with a ton > of new features. Among them are enhanced XRef scene support for team > collaboration, enhanced importers/exporters and more. > > I've been doing a lot of work to make it simple to design your Source > levels and assets entirely inside 3ds Max (no Hammer, no VTFEdit required). > > Here are some recent videos showing some of the tools in action: > > > > - https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=r38elrL1DGI > - https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=pn2Sv8yxmDU > - https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=4rxTv0pFp5U > - https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=jWelLe_yPDI > > > > You can get Wall Worm at http://dev.wallworm.com/ .
